So I had my golf lesson today and it went really well. My instructor is confident that if I can break some of my bad habits I will break 100 in no time. She said My goal should be to break 95 not 100....I told her she is a big dreamer haha.

I am going to play 9 holes with her in 2 week and I can't wait! She said to get out and practice what we went over for the next few weeks and then we will play 9 together. She wants to know what I am thinking and how my course maintenance is. I plan to be at the range bright and early tomorrow to work on the issues we talked about today. I was making my swing work harder then it needed to and having too much turn with my take away so by the time I finished I was wrapping the club around my body causing a nasty hook. She keeps reminding me it's all about the tilted L.

I really hope I have a good range session tomorrow and I can remember to work on the things she told me.

She was also telling me to work on just taking practice swings. She said to set up the club in the air by my knees and take a practice swing where the club never touches the ground. This will help me control my take away and speed. She played on the LPGA for some years and she said these were the same drills her instructor made her do. If it helped get her to where she was then what the heck I can give it a try ha.
